Arrival Story:
One of the reasons my ex and I hooked up was that we found out that we had both always wanted a Jack Russell named Jack. We found ours at a horrible puppy mill (*didn't know that at the time*). Of course, the marriage crashed and burned like, 45 minutes later - originally Jack was going to be with the ex, and then he asked me to take him. I was so scared that I'd screw up.. I'd never had to care for a little creature before! It was great practise for mommyhood. I love my Jack and he's still going strong 11 years later!
